比特币钱包的签名认证详解:确保您的数字资产
在数字货币快速发展的今天,比特币作为一种去中心化的资产,受到越来越多投资者的关注。比特币钱包作为存储和管理这些数字资产的关键工具,其安全性显得尤为重要。而签名认证作为比特币钱包中一个至关重要的概念,在确保交易的有效性和完整性方面发挥着重要作用。本文将对比特币钱包的签名认证进行详细剖析,为广大数字货币爱好者提供帮助。
什么是比特币钱包?
比特币钱包是一种用来存储、发送和接收比特币的数字工具。与传统的银行账户不同,比特币钱包并不存储实际的比特币,而是持有对应的公钥和私钥。公钥可以类比于银行账户号码,允许其他人向你发送比特币;而私钥则相当于密码,只有持有该私钥的人才能操作账户,进行比特币的转移。
比特币钱包以不同的形式存在,诸如硬件钱包、软件钱包、移动钱包和在线钱包等。硬件钱包被认为是最安全的一种,因为它将私钥保存在离线设备中,有效降低了黑客攻击的风险。而软件和在线钱包则更为方便,但其安全性相对较低,用户需要格外小心以防止信息泄露。
签名认证的基本概念
签名认证是比特币交易中的核心功能之一,主要用于验证交易的真实性和完整性。简单来说,当用户发起一笔比特币交易时,需要通过其私钥对交易信息进行数字签名,这个过程称为“数字签名”。在区块链网络中,任何人都可以使用对应的公钥验证该签名,从而确认交易是否由持有该私钥的用户发起,确保交易的合法性。
数字签名不仅可以使交易变得可追溯,确保交易的不可伪造性,还能够通过校验签名的有效性来防止数据在传输过程中的篡改。因此,签名认证在比特币网络中是保证交易安全和防止欺诈行为的重要机制。
比特币钱包如何进行签名认证?
在比特币钱包中,签名认证的过程可以概括为以下几个步骤:
- 生成交易信息:用户在比特币钱包中生成一笔交易信息,基本内容包括发件人地址(公钥)、收件人地址、交易金额及相关手续费。
- 创建交易哈希:钱包将生成的交易信息经过哈希函数加密,生成一个唯一的交易哈希值(Transaction ID)。
- 数字签名生成:用户用私钥对该交易哈希进行加密,生成数字签名。这个签名包含有关于交易的所有必要信息,用以证明该交易的有效性。
- 发送交易:数字签名连同交易哈希一同发送至比特币网络,网络中的节点会接收到该交易并进行验证。
- 验证签名:比特币网络中的节点使用发件人的公钥对交易进行验证,检查签名的有效性。如果签名验证通过,交易将被添加到区块链中。
整个过程确保了交易的不可伪造性和完整性,从而维护了比特币网络的安全性。
为何签名认证对比特币钱包至关重要?
1. **防止欺诈**:数字签名确保了交易的真实性。如果没有签名认证,恶意行为者可以很容易地伪造交易,将比特币从其他用户的账户转移到自己的账户。通过签名认证,网络节点能够确认每笔交易的发起者真实身份,从而有效防止欺诈。
2. **保护用户隐私**:尽管比特币交易在区块链上是公开的,但用户的信息(如私钥)始终保持私密。数字签名仅使用公钥进行验证,因此用户的身份信息不会被泄露,这在保护用户隐私方面至关重要。
3. **不可篡改性**:一旦交易被签名并加入区块链,任何人都无法修改这笔交易的信息。即便是发起交易的用户,也无法撤回或修改已经确认的交易,这使得比特币的交易记录具有高度的不可篡改性。
4. **共识机制的稳定性**:比特币采用的是工作量证明的共识机制,签名认证是维持这一机制正常运转的重要环节。没有数字签名,网络中的节点就无法一致地确认每笔交易,从而影响整个网络的稳定性。
在使用比特币钱包时应注意的几点事项
1. **保护私钥**:私钥是您比特币钱包的核心,务必将其保存在安全的位置,切勿与他人分享。考虑使用硬件钱包或冷钱包来防护私钥。
2. **定期备份钱包**:定期备份比特币钱包,以防止意外情况的发生,如设备损坏等。确保备份文件安全存储,且与互联网孤立。
3. **警惕网络钓鱼**:很多网络钓鱼攻击伪装成合法平台,诱使用户泄露私钥等敏感信息。确保只在官方和可信的网站上进行交易,并启用二次验证。
4. **关注安全更新**:不断更新您的钱包和防病毒软件,以防止因破解和漏洞而产生的资金损失。在选择钱包时,可以参考社区和技术评测,选择信誉良好的产品。
相关问题和详细解答
一、比特币钱包的类型和选择标准是什么?
比特币钱包有多种类型,每种类型在安全性、使用便捷性和功能上都有所不同。主要的类型包括:
- 硬件钱包:如Ledger和Trezor,这类钱包将私钥存储在物理设备中,通常被认为是最安全的选择,适合长期持有比特币的用户。
- 软件钱包:如Electrum和Exodus,运行在电脑或手机上的钱包,使用起来比较方便,但安全性较低。
- 在线钱包:如Coinbase和Blockchain.com,这类钱包托管在云端,方便访问,但相对而言,风险较大,因为可能遭受黑客攻击。
- 纸钱包:这是一种将私钥和公钥打印在纸上的方法,虽然安全性高,但不方便操作,一旦丢失,无法恢复。
在选择比特币钱包时,用户应根据自己的需求进行选择,如频繁交易可能更适合在线钱包,而长期保管则建议选择硬件钱包。同时,注意钱包提供的安全功能,比如多重签名和两步验证等。
二、如何确保比特币交易的安全性?
在进行比特币交易时,确保安全性是每位用户的首要任务。以下是一些有效的措施:
- 使用强密码:确保您的钱包有一个强密码,避免使用简单的常见密码。
- 启用二步验证:尽量启用钱包和交易所的二步验证,这能够大大增加额外的安全层次。
- 保持软件更新:确保使用最新版本的钱包软件,防止因使用过时软件而导致的安全问题。
- 小心网络环境:尽量避免在公共Wi-Fi下进行比特币交易,使用私密和安全的网络环境。
通过以上方法,您可以有效提高比特币交易的安全性,保护您的数字资产不受威胁。
三、使用比特币钱包时遭遇问题如何解决?
使用比特币钱包时,可能会遭遇一些常见问题,如无法发送或接收比特币、钱包崩溃或丢失访问权限等。解决这些问题可以参考以下建议:
- 检查网络连接:在发送或接收比特币前,确保您的网络连接正常,这是导致交易失败的常见原因。
- 查找交易记录:使用区块链浏览器查看您的交易记录,确认交易是否真正被发送或接收。
- 联系客服:如果遇到无法解决的问题,可以直接联系钱包的客户支持团队获取帮助,他们通常能提供专业的技术支持。
- 查阅帮助文档:大多数钱包都提供丰富的帮助文档,用户可以根据相关问题快速找到解决方案。
通过这些步骤,用户可以更有效地解决在使用比特币钱包过程中所遇到的问题,确保数字资产的安全和顺利交易。
四、比特币钱包的未来发展趋势是什么?
随着技术的不断进步和人们对数字货币的认可,加密资产钱包的发展也将迎来新的机遇。未来的发展趋势包括:
- 增强的安全性:钱包将采用更先进的加密技术,如多重签名和生物识别技术,以增强对用户资产的保护。
- 更便捷的用户体验:为用户提供更加友好的操作界面,降低新手的学习曲线,让更多人能够轻松使用比特币钱包。
- 多币种支持:未来的数字钱包不仅可能支持比特币,还支持其他加密货币,为用户提供一站式的管理平台。
- 与金融系统的整合:随着区块链技术的逐渐成熟,钱包可能逐渐与传统金融系统整合,使得数字资产的使用变得更加便捷。
综合来看,比特币钱包的未来将更加安全、便捷,同时为用户提供更良好的服务和体验。通过不断学习和关注这些变化,用户能够更好地掌握数字货币的使用,提升自身的投资体验。
综上所述,比特币钱包的签名认证是确保交易安全和有效的关键机制,掌握这一机制对于每位比特币用户至关重要。通过对比特币钱包的全面了解和安全实践的遵循,用户才能在这个数字货币的世界中游刃有余,保障自身的数字资产安全。